This week, our top stories are:
 
#3 - Levittown's Crossfit Revenge Holds Run for the Beach Fundraiser - Levittown's Crossfit Revenge recently held a fundraiser to help out those still feeling the devastating impact of Hurricane Sandy in one especially hard-hit area: Long Beach, NY. Check out the video story here. 

#2 TIE: Island Trees Youth Football Player Named Among Best in Nation

Liam Siegler, a 7th grader at ITMS and defensive tackle for the football team, has been named by The Football University (FBU) as one of the best 7th-8th grade football players in the country.  

7th Annual Levittown Coat Drive a Huge Success - Levittown resident blew past her goals for this year's coat drive, which goes to various local organizations for those in need.

Levittown Residents Participate in NBC 4's Annual Holiday Sing-Along - A couple of lucky Levittown residents recently won the chance to sing with News 4 New York at its famed annual holiday sing-along, on the iconic ice skating rink in Rockefeller Plaza on Friday, Nov. 30.

#1 - Levittown Man Arrested in Holbrook Hit-and-Run - Police said that James Byrnes, 26, was arrested after police said he fled the scene of a car accident that he caused in Holbrook on Sunrise Highway.
